CVE-2021-24375 in Motor Themeinfo

Summary

by MITRE • 07/06/2021

Lack of authentication or validation in motor_load_more, motor_gallery_load_more, motor_quick_view and motor_project_quick_view AJAX handlers of the Motor WordPress theme before 3.1.0 allows an unauthenticated attacker access to arbitrary files in the server file system, and to execute arbitrary php scripts found on the server file system. We found no vulnerability for uploading files with this theme, so any scripts to be executed must already be on the server file system.

The CVE-2021-24375 vulnerability represents a critical authentication and authorization flaw within the Motor WordPress theme affecting versions prior to 3.1.0. This vulnerability manifests through four specific AJAX handlers: motor_load_more, motor_gallery_load_more, motor_quick_view, and motor_project_quick_view. These handlers lack proper authentication mechanisms and input validation, creating a pathway for unauthenticated attackers to exploit the theme's functionality. The vulnerability stems from insufficient access controls that fail to verify user credentials or permissions before processing requests, directly violating fundamental security principles of least privilege and proper authentication.

The technical implementation of this vulnerability allows attackers to manipulate the AJAX handlers to access arbitrary files within the server's file system. This occurs because the theme's code does not validate the source or legitimacy of requests sent to these handlers, enabling malicious actors to craft requests that traverse the file system and retrieve sensitive data. The vulnerability also permits execution of arbitrary PHP scripts that already exist on the server, meaning attackers can leverage existing malicious code rather than requiring upload capabilities. This execution capability represents a severe compromise as it allows for remote code execution on the target server, potentially enabling full system compromise. The absence of file upload capabilities in this specific vulnerability means that attackers must already have PHP scripts present on the server to achieve execution, but this still represents a significant security risk as it allows for exploitation of existing malicious payloads.

The operational impact of CVE-2021-24375 extends beyond simple data exposure, as it creates a persistent threat vector that can be exploited repeatedly without requiring additional compromise steps. Attackers can leverage this vulnerability to enumerate server directories, access configuration files, database credentials, and other sensitive information stored in the file system. The ability to execute arbitrary PHP code transforms this vulnerability from a mere information disclosure issue into a full remote code execution threat. Mitigation strategies for CVE-2021-24375 require immediate action to upgrade to Motor theme version 3.1.0 or later, which contains the necessary authentication and validation patches. System administrators should also implement additional protective measures including restricting access to AJAX endpoints through web application firewalls, implementing rate limiting to prevent automated exploitation attempts, and conducting comprehensive security audits of the WordPress installation. Network segmentation and monitoring solutions should be deployed to detect anomalous requests to these AJAX handlers.
